☐ Import wizard key check — Quillbasin CSV tools. Plugin authors: verify the wizard's signing key matches the ceremony manifest before publishing column-mapper plugins. Mismatched signatures are rejected at upload. Do not regenerate keys locally. When the steward calls your slot, unlock the escrow bundle with the phrase that follows.

unlock words, haduf-hadup: holox-rusion-julwyn-drudor-praok-pelius-druion-casael-lamath-pelix

# Bulk Edit Limits — Quornish Admin Table

Welcome aboard. Before running bulk edits in the Quornish admin table, read this page carefully. Bulk operations are throttled to protect the primary database at Fernholt Systems: each batch is validated, applied inside a transaction, and rolled back entirely on any row failure. Exceeding the quota returns a soft error, not a ban, but repeated violations page the platform team. The current limits and batch constants are defined below.

tuning constants:
QUOTAS = {
    "druwyn": 5,
    "holix": 5,
    "zorath": 5,
    "holwyn": 10,
}

Handover — Wicklow wiki RBAC. Done: role matrix migrated, Steward grants audited, stale Contributor accounts revoked. Pending: group-sync job still double-counts nested teams; fix is drafted, not merged. Watch the permission cache after deploys — it lags about ten minutes. Runbook lives in the Admin space. For the weekly sync: no blockers, just the pending merge. Ongoing ownership of RBAC transfers to the person named below.

account owner for bawip-fajeg: Ralix Oliwyn

# Env file — Cartwheel dispatch, driver-assignment heuristic
# Scope: staging only. Do not promote to prod.
# The heuristic weights (proximity, shift balance, refusal rate) are tuned
# for the Velmont pilot region and will misbehave elsewhere.
# Review notes: heuristic service runs unprivileged; it reads weights
# read-only from the tuning store and writes nothing back.
# Only one sensitive value exists in this file: the tuning-store access
# credential, consumed at boot and never logged.
# That credential is set on the following line.

secret setting of faduf-bahop: LEDGER_TOKEN8=c3b363be